The glass transition temperature of nonstoichiometric epoxy–amine networks
Authors:C I Vallo  P M Frontini  R J J Williams
Abstract:Glass transition temperatures (Tg) of nonstoichiometric epoxy-amine networks based on the diglycidylether of bisphenol A (DGEBA), are analyzed in terms of the network structure. In most cases reasonable predictions of Tg can be made using an empirical equation reported by L. E. Nielsen together with the experimental Tg value of the stoichiometric network and statistical calculations of the concentration of elastic chains. It is stated that in these rigid networks the concentration of elastic chains is the main structural factor associated to the variations of Tg with stoichiometry. For flexible networks based on the diglycidylether of butanediol (DGEBD), the effect of elastic chains on the Tg value is much less significant.
